When choosing a portable solar panel, consumers often face a tradeoff between power capacity and portability. The Renogy 100W Portable Solar Panel provides substantial energy output suitable for multiple devices, but at a larger size and weight. Conversely, Goal Zero Nomad 50 prioritizes compactness and convenience, making it ideal for quick setup and travel. This comparison highlights these key differences, helping users decide whether they need raw power or portability for outdoor adventures, emergencies, or everyday use.

Key Differences

The primary distinction between these options lies in their power capacity versus portability. The Renogy 100W panel delivers nearly double the power of the Goal Zero Nomad 50, making it suitable for longer trips or powering multiple devices simultaneously. Its larger size and weight reflect this increased capacity, which may be less convenient for quick carry or minimalist setups. Meanwhile, the Goal Zero Nomad 50 emphasizes lightweight, compact design, ideal for users prioritizing ease of transport and quick deployment. In practice, this means the Renogy is better suited for extended outdoor use where high power is needed, whereas the Goal Zero excels in scenarios demanding quick setup and minimal bulk.

Detailed Comparison

Power Output (Renogy 100W Portable Solar Panel wins — major)

The Renogy 100W outperforms the Goal Zero Nomad 50 by providing twice the wattage. This results in faster charging times and the ability to power more devices simultaneously, which is a major advantage for extended outdoor trips or emergencies. The gap is major, translating directly into practical benefits for users needing higher energy capacity.

Size & Weight (Goal Zero Nomad 50 Solar Panel wins — moderate)

The Goal Zero Nomad 50 is significantly smaller and lighter, making it far easier to carry and store. Its compact form factor is advantageous for travelers or those with limited space. The size difference is moderate but impactful in real-world portability, especially for quick setup or storage in small backpacks.

Durability (Renogy 100W Portable Solar Panel wins — minor)

Both panels are weather-resistant, but the Renogy features a more rugged, sturdy frame designed for rough conditions. Goal Zero’s panel is also durable but emphasizes lightweight construction. The difference is minor but meaningful for users expecting harsh conditions.

Ease of Use (Goal Zero Nomad 50 Solar Panel wins — minor)

The Goal Zero Nomad 50 offers plug-and-play functionality with an integrated stand, making it very simple for beginners or quick setups. The Renogy requires more setup, connecting to batteries or devices. This makes the Goal Zero more user-friendly for casual users, with a minor gap in convenience.

Price (Goal Zero Nomad 50 Solar Panel wins — minor)

The Goal Zero Nomad 50 is generally less expensive, around $150, while the Renogy 100W is more expensive at about $250. The price difference reflects the power capacity and build quality, which may influence budget-conscious buyers or those needing higher output.

Portability (Goal Zero Nomad 50 Solar Panel wins — moderate)

Weight and size favor Goal Zero, which is designed for portability and quick deployment. Renogy’s larger size reduces portability, making it better suited for stationary setups or longer trips where weight is less critical. The difference is moderate but crucial for users prioritizing travel convenience.

Compatibility (Renogy 100W Portable Solar Panel wins — minor)

Renogy panels are compatible with a wide range of batteries and USB devices, offering flexibility for different setups. Goal Zero panels are optimized for Goal Zero power banks but also support USB devices. The gap is minor, with both offering broad compatibility.

Frequently Asked Questions

Can the Goal Zero Nomad 50 charge multiple devices at once?

Yes, it has multiple USB ports, allowing simultaneous charging of several USB devices, but its lower wattage limits the overall charging speed and capacity compared to larger panels.

Is the Renogy 100W panel suitable for backpacking?

While portable, its weight and size make it more suitable for vehicle-based setups or longer trips where carrying additional weight is acceptable. It is less ideal for ultralight backpacking.

Which panel is better for emergency preparedness?

The Renogy 100W offers higher power, making it more versatile for emergency power needs. The Goal Zero Nomad 50 is more convenient for quick deployment but limited in output.

Are both panels compatible with portable power banks?

Yes, both are compatible with most portable power banks, but Renogy’s higher wattage provides more flexibility and faster charging options.

Does the weather resistance cover all environmental conditions?

Both panels are weather-resistant, suitable for rain and moderate weather. For extreme conditions, consider additional protective measures or more rugged models.
